SB 9.20.29

भरतस्य महत्कर्म न पूर्वे नापरे नृपाः नैवापुर्नैव प्राप्स्यन्ति बाहुभ्यां त्रिदिवं यथा

bharatasya mahat karma na pūrve nāpare nṛpāḥ naivāpur naiva prāpsyanti bāhubhyāṁ tridivaṁ yathā

Synonyms

bharatasyaof Mahārāja Bharata, the son of Mahārāja Duṣmanta; mahatvery great, exalted; karmaactivities; naneither; pūrvepreviously; nanor; apareafter his time; nṛpāḥkings as a class; naneither; evacertainly; āpuḥattained; nanor; evacertainly; prāpsyantiwill get; bāhubhyāmby the strength of his arms; tri-divamthe heavenly planets; yathāas..

Translation

As one cannot approach the heavenly planets simply by the strength of his arms (for who can touch the heavenly planets with his hands?), one cannot imitate the wonderful activities of Mahārāja Bharata. No one could perform such activities in the past, nor will anyone be able to do so in the future.
